New TV up and running, old TV moved to the bedroom that already had a TV with magic eye sky connection all working fine.
Tuned the moved TV in to the Sky signal and it shows the picture the same as downstairs, the magic eye LED is on but the remote isn't talking to it. scratchchin
If I reconnect the original TV it all works fine, so no cable issues, but what ever I try I can't get the new one to work. banghead

Gave that a try....and no luck, but late last night I had a thought, I recently moved the room about and the TV needed a very long coax extension, now this didn't seem to bother the Sony but I moved the Magic eye box to the join between the original cable and the extension.....and bounce it works.
Only down side is the magic eye is now on the opposite wall to the TV so to change channel it's a bit weird pointing the remote in the opposite direction rotate
